In his presentation, Gerald Knaus argues that migration fears drive populist leaders like Viktor Orban and Donald Trump to undermine post-war liberal democracies. Using examples from Austria, France, Italy, and Germany, Dr Knaus will demonstrate how these fears have enabled the far-right to achieve their strongest results in recent European elections. He offers suggestions on how to improve migration management in Europe by moving towards a more humane legal system which balances border control and human rights by introducing fast and fair asylum procedures, strategic deportations, and legal mobility for migrants. He also discusses partnership agreements and other options to deter illegal migration.
About the Speaker:
Gerald Knaus is an Austrian migration expert and a well-known advisor on migration policy. He is the founding chairman of the European Stability Initiative (ESI) think tank and a founding member of the European Council on Foreign Relations. An accomplished author, in 2020, he published the award-winning SPIEGEL bestseller “What Borders Do We Need?” and prior to that he wrote a book in 2011 with the British writer and then politician Rory Stewart entitled: “Can Intervention Work? He was an Associate Fellow at the Kennedy School in Harvard University for five years and has lectured at the Institute for Human Sciences (IWM) in Vienna, at the State University of Ukraine and at the NATO College in Rome. Apart from refugee issues, his expertise covers economics, southern Europe and the Balkans, rule of law in Europe, and corruption.
